So I drove quite a bit today, went 100 or so miles along M25/M1 to pick up some alloys. All seemed well. Car was parked up for around 20 minuites while I talked to the bloke and gave him my hard earned cash, then I set off again back down the M1
After about 5-10 minuites it seemed to lose power, then on next gear change it wouldnt go past 3k revs. I changed down again and took it slow for about a minuite, then the throttle stopped working! I started worrying now as I was 100 miles away from home :grin: Pulled up on the side and tried to rev it, seemed like it was trying but then gave up, so I turned engine off for a few minuites and started up again, all was back to normal so I drove home. Everythng was fine for the rest of the journey
Whats going on? :laugh:
Edit: I have an AUM

Sounds like a torque monitor fault, which could have been down to a sticky throttle body. I would get your fault codes checked asap.
